- [ ] Before the Quillhaven signing ceremony proceeds, run the leaked-file-descriptor hunt on the offline signer. As a new contractor, please be thorough: enumerate every open descriptor on the sealed host, confirm nothing points at the ceremony scratch volume, and log each finding in the Larkspur register. If any descriptor traces back to the retired Fenwick exporter, halt and page the ceremony lead. Once the host shows a clean descriptor table, unlock the escrow envelope using the phrase below.

unlock words, yajof-tagef: aldiel-kasath-briax-fraeth-pelius-olieth-pelix-wenius-wenael-norael

Subject: DR drill — Quillforge rendering performance stack

Hi Maret,

As part of Thursday's disaster-recovery drill, we will restore the Quillforge template-rendering performance environment from cold storage, including the benchmark baselines you reviewed last sprint. Please verify the restored configs match the approved branch before we re-enable traffic. To unseal the backup archive during the drill, the recovery passphrase is given below.

unlock words, hahip-yagef: zorok-novmir-zorix-silax

Handover for the weekly sync: dependency pinning policy for the Orvane monorepo. Short version — everything gets exact pins now, no caret ranges, and the bot opens weekly bump PRs batched by workspace. Lockfile drift checks run in CI and block merges. Policy exceptions need a one-line rationale, approved by:

approver of bagug-bagag = Holael Pramir

The tailcast CLI now supports live filtering across the Fernwick staging clusters. Run tailcast follow with a service name to stream logs, or add the severity flag to cut noise. Output defaults to structured JSON; pass the plain flag for human-readable lines. Authentication against the Lanternlog gateway is required before first use. Configure your session with the key below.

app token of yajeg-kawef = kto11_7En3XSX8xQw